    Quote Originally Posted by Havok83 View Post
    what is the current status quo of the Royal family?
    They aren't royal anymore, they abdicated, they killed extraterrestrial inhumans (not Terran ones), they have no books except for Ms. Marvel, and Black Bolt is set to make an appearance in a Darkholm book at the end of the year.

    Technically they were the royal family of Attila, which is in the Hudson River now. I think Cates wanted to write a pre-Inhumanity story, so they shoved New Arctilian at the last moment because they hadn't been living on the Moon for a long time. That city was a part of the cheap reset that lasted one issue before Marvel having everyone living in New Arctilian massacred. So basically they're back to where they were at the end of IvX.

    I think many writers just remember the inhumans from the 80's and ignore they're advancements in the past two decades including freeing the Alpha Primitives and moving from a monarchy to a republic.
